So caterham is coming back for Abu Dhabi, marussia is apparently not coming back and will lose their entry for next year. there's still the weirdness with who Alonso will replace, and the sauber situation with van der garde apparently having a contract. there's going to be a fair amount of attrition here. ugh this track.

So the Caterham lineup is Will Stevens (a surprise) and Kamui Kobayashi. Marussia is after all that probably not showing up, and as such, most likely not making it to next year. Lotus, Force India, and Sauber are no doubt trying to get the payout reorganized (rightfully so in my mind). Shitty track here we come.

Does anyone know specifically what happened to Nico Rosberg's car? This seems like a real shitty way to determine the world champion…
Flying Fish 11/23/14 (Sun) 20:57:17 daf4e3 No. 452
>>451 From what I gathered Nico had:
- a bad start
- ERS went down
- Mercedes engine problems
- brake problems
…amongst other things. The commentators were talking about how he had to reset the systems, like turning a computer on and off.
